Looks A to me..

Reason -- (I'll start from the ones which are easy to Eliminate)

Option D --incorrect usage 'Was' should be replaced by 'Were'
option E -- Awkward... 'crafting' is incorrect.. [somehow I think the usage should be 'Not only... But Also' to maintain the parallelism]
option C -- Same as E.. not parallel.
option B -- Incorrect usage of Past Perfect Tense. It should be simple past tense.

Option A is the clear winner :)
